Tracy, CA
Pros
Households earn $48,706 more per year on average
Stronger job market — unemployment is 1.2 pts lower (5.4%)
Milder winters — January highs near 57°F vs 32°F
Cons
Pricier housing — median home is $617,300
Higher rents — median is $2,162/mo
Longer commutes — 43.5 min average each way
Cost of living runs 4% higher than Worcester
Worcester, MA
Pros
Homes cost $312k less ($305,600 vs $617,300)
95% less violent crime than Tracy
Rent averages $850/mo less ($1,312 vs $2,162)
Commutes run 19 min shorter each way
Violent crime is well below the national average (16.5 vs 380/100k)
More college-educated — 33.1% hold a bachelor's or higher
Cons
Median income trails Tracy by $48,706/yr
Higher unemployment (6.6% vs 5.4%)
Snowy winters — about 73" of snow per year
